The first crisis will occur when the contractor bids are greater than the budget estimate. Bare is exactly that; it is the bare cost of the direct activities less any mark ups for labor burden, taxes, bond, overhead and profit. All direct costs are then adjusted to include home office overhead and profit for the installing contractor.

A project cost should also include the indirect costs such as site specific overhead (indirectly attributable to all the project direct costs and can be 5% to 15% of project cost), home office overhead, profit, bond, sales taxes and even certain contingencies.
